HGH Reconstitution and Measuring

Follow these 4 easy steps for HGH Reconsitution

Reconstituting HGH

Use alcohol and swab to clean the top of your HGH vial and the diluent water.

HGH Reconstitution

Take a 1cc syringe with a 23 or 25 gauge needle (1″ or 1.5″) and draw up the amount of your preferred diluent. The amount isn’t critical, other than making sure you know exactly how much you have used. The rule of thumb is choose an amount that will make measuring the final product easy.

1ml (cc) per 10IU vial of HGH means each 10 mark on U100 syringe equals 1 IU of HGH
2ml (cc) added to a 10 IU vial of HGH means each 20 mark on a U100 syringe equal 1 IU of HGH
3ml (cc) added to a 10 IU vial of HGH means the 30 mark on U100 syringe would equal 1 IU of HGH

Then you take the syringe (already having the diluent) and push it into the vial containing the lyophilized powder, you may want to angle it so that the needle touches the side of the vial, and avoiding injecting the diluent directly onto the lyophilized powder, you want to make it run slowly down the side of the vial (don’t force it all at once or don’t rush it in).

After all of the diluent has been added to the vial of HGH, gently swirl (do NOT agitate or violently shake the vial) until the lyophilized powder has dissolved and you are left with a clear liquid. The HGH is now ready to use. Store your reconstituted HGH in the refrigerator and if you used bacteriostatic water to reconstitute, it will be good for about three weeks. If you used sterile water, then it will only be good for about 4 -5 days.

You have reconstituted the HGH, now you need to know how to measure the amount for injection right? Use a U-100 Insulin Syringe to draw and inject the HGH. Here’s how: since you know the amount of IU’s in your HGH vial and you know how much water you have diluted it with, just divide as listed below: You need to know the following:

1ml = 1cc = 100 IU’s

So take the number of IU’s of the HGH off of the label of the lyophilized powder (most common is 4 or 10 IU’s) divide that into the amount of diluent we used.

Example:

We used 1cc or a ml. of water; we also have a 10 IU vial of HGH.

We know from above that 1cc = 100 IU’s, so we have 100 IU’s of water.

We now divide the 100 IU’s (the amount of our water) by 10 IU’s (the amount of HGH)

100 IU / 10 IU = 10

This 10 will perfectly correspond with the markings on a U100 insulin syringe. In our example, every 10 mark on the syringe will equal 1 IU of HGH. You want to draw 2 IU’s of GH? …Draw out to the 20 mark on the syringe.
